| 正面描述 | Bare-necked, laureate bust of Emperor Nero facing right, rendered in the naturalistic portraiture style characteristic of early Neronian coinage. The effigy displays the emperor's distinctive youthful features with carefully delineated laurel wreath and curled hair arranged across the nape of the neck. The circumferential Latin legend runs around the periphery of the flan, partially visible on this worn specimen. The portrait is executed in moderately high relief typical of aes coinage of the Julio-Claudian period. |

| 背面描述 | The reverse depicts the rectangular Temple of Janus Geminus shown in three-quarter perspective, its arched facade featuring a latticed window to the right and double-panelled doors to the left, with a festive garland draped across the closed doorway — symbolising the rare closure of the Janus temple in celebration of universal Roman peace. The senatorial authorisation mark S C (Senatus Consultum) appears prominently in the field, flanking the temple structure, as was standard on Imperial aes coinage. The encircling legend commemorates Nero's celebrated closing of the gates of Janus, an act performed only a handful of times in Roman history. The design is executed in low to moderate relief on an irregularly shaped bronze flan. |
